It’s been a bit of a rollercoaster ride for Braden Schneider , but New York Rangers coach Mike Sullivan believes the young defenseman is in a good spot heading into the final three games of the 2025-26 season. “I think he is playing extremely well right now,” Sullivan said Friday , before the Rangers departed for Dallas, where they’ll skate against the Stars on Saturday. And why does Sullivan believe the 24-year-old defenseman is so good these days?
“When he’s simple with his puck possession, the decisions he’s making with the puck are good. He’s executing when he has the opportunity to go tape to tape. When he’s not, he’s recognizing when to make a simple play.
And I just think that’s an important element of being a good defenseman in today’s game,” Sullivan explained. “He’s not a guy that’s forcing plays and giving our opponents an opportunity off turnovers, feeding a transition game. … I think ‘Schneids’ has done a good job most recently with his puck possession and recognizing the difference.
He’s also making plays when they’re there. ” Schneider admitted that being back on the second or third defense pair helped the overall improvement in his game. Earlier this season, he stepped into a top-pair role alongside Vladislav Gavrikov, when Adam Fox missed 27 games during two extended injury absences through December and January.
